Community Kitchen

Our Community Kitchen services are open all year round, serving hundreds of meals every week to hungry guests including those who access Sufra’s services and beyond. Our Community Kitchens are a place to come together and build community, while sharing a delicious meal.

Community Kitchen

The Kitchen runs on the following days with support from our partners at Brent Council and Laurence’s Larder:

  • Mondays, Tuesdays
    & Wednesdays

    6PM TO 8PM

    New Horizons Centre
    1 Robson Avenue
    NW10 3SG

  • Thursdays

    12PM TO 2PM

    Laurence’s Larder
    Christchurch Ave
    Willesden Ln
    NW6 7BJ

Guests are served free, freshly-cooked, 2 or 3 course hot meal. You can simply come along without prior booking and enjoy great food and company in a welcoming community setting.

Throughout the year, we regularly host themed dinner nights to celebrate the community’s cultural diversity – such as Christmas, Ramadan and Diwali.
